Why is it masculine?
Países is masculine because it derives from the Latin "pagensis," which evolved into the Spanish noun form while retaining its masculine gender. In Spanish, nouns ending in -ís are typically masculine, and "país" follows this pattern along with other similar words like "turquí" and "marroquí."
